There's certainly going to be a lot of reaction from local fans and media when a new general manager is brought in to run their franchise, and such is the case with the Edmonton Oilers and Ken Holland.
Brought in after over two decades with the Detroit Red Wings with a 5 year, $25 million deal, his resume is packed with triumphs, but in recent years he's been called into question for several deals and trades he's made.
